Vous voulez créer votre propre jeu vidéo ? Vous pensez qu’il faut être un expert en code et avoir un gros budget pour se lancer ? C’est une idée reçue.

Aujourd’hui, de nombreuses applications permettent de développer un jeu facilement, même sans écrire une seule ligne de code. Ce guide vous présente les 9 meilleures applications gratuites pour créer un jeu vidéo, avec une analyse pour vous aider à choisir celle qui correspond à votre projet.

Tableau Comparatif des 9 Meilleures Applications pour Créer un Jeu Vidéo Gratuitement

Pour vous aider à choisir rapidement, voici un résumé des meilleures options disponibles. Chaque application a ses points forts, que ce soit pour les débutants ou pour des projets plus avancés.

Nom du logiciel Idéal pour… Niveau requis Plateformes Lien
GDevelop Jeux 2D sans code Débutant Web, Windows, macOS, Mobile Accéder à GDevelop
Construct 3 Jeux 2D dans le navigateur Débutant Web Découvrir Construct
Unity Projets 2D et 3D ambitieux Intermédiaire Multiplateforme Se lancer avec Unity
Unreal Engine Graphismes 3D de haute qualité Avancé PC, Consoles, VR Explorer Unreal Engine
Godot Engine Projets 2D/3D open-source Intermédiaire Multiplateforme Télécharger Godot
RPG Maker VX Jeux de rôle de style rétro Débutant Windows Voir RPG Maker
CryEngine Jeux 3D photoréalistes Avancé PC, Consoles Découvrir CryEngine
Gamemaker Développement rapide de jeux 2D Débutant / Intermédiaire Multiplateforme Essayer Gamemaker
LÖVE Apprendre le code avec LUA Intermédiaire Multiplateforme Découvrir LÖVE

Analyse Détaillée des 9 Meilleurs Logiciels de Création de Jeux

Maintenant, regardons plus en détail chaque application pour que vous puissiez faire le meilleur choix pour votre premier jeu.

1. GDevelop : Le choix idéal sans code pour les débutants

GDevelop est parfait pour débuter sans savoir coder. C’est un moteur de jeu open-source qui fonctionne avec un système de logique visuelle. Vous n’écrivez pas de code, vous construisez les mécaniques de votre jeu avec des blocs d’événements. C’est très intuitif.

Son interface de type « glisser-déposer » vous permet de placer des objets et de définir leur comportement facilement. Une fois votre création terminée, vous pouvez exporter votre jeu partout : sur le web (HTML5), sur mobile (Android, iOS) ou sur PC (Windows, macOS, Linux). C’est une excellente porte d’entrée dans la création de jeux.

  • Point fort : Ne nécessite aucune connaissance en programmation.
  • Pour qui : Les nouveaux créateurs qui veulent un résultat rapide.

Pour commencer votre propre jeu vidéo, vous pouvez accéder à GDevelop directement.

2. Construct 3 : La puissance de la 2D dans votre navigateur

Construct 3 est un autre moteur de jeu 2D qui ne demande pas de savoir coder. Sa particularité est qu’il fonctionne entièrement en ligne, directement dans votre navigateur. Pas besoin d’installer quoi que ce soit sur votre ordinateur. Vous pouvez commencer à créer votre jeu en quelques secondes.

Comme GDevelop, il utilise un système d’événements visuels. Il est très performant pour créer des jeux de plateforme, des puzzles ou des shoot’em up. La version gratuite a quelques limitations, mais elle est suffisante pour créer un jeu complet et se faire la main. Pour les créateurs nomades, c’est une très bonne option.

Pour essayer cet outil web, vous pouvez découvrir Construct.

3. Unity : Le moteur polyvalent pour les projets 2D et 3D

Unity est l’un des moteurs de jeu les plus populaires au monde. Il a été utilisé pour créer des jeux connus comme Among Us ou The Forest. Il permet de faire des jeux en 2D comme en 3D, ce qui le rend très polyvalent. Sa version gratuite, « Personal », est très complète et permet de publier vos créations.

Pour utiliser Unity, il faut apprendre le langage C#, mais la communauté est immense. Vous trouverez des tonnes de tutoriels, de forums et de ressources pour vous aider. Son « Asset Store » est une mine d’or où vous pouvez trouver des modèles 3D, des sons et des scripts tout prêts. C’est un excellent choix si vous êtes prêt à investir un peu de temps pour apprendre.

Pour vous lancer dans un projet plus ambitieux, vous pouvez se lancer avec Unity.

4. Unreal Engine : La référence pour des graphismes époustouflants

Si vous voulez créer un jeu avec une qualité graphique AAA, Unreal Engine est le moteur qu’il vous faut. C’est l’outil derrière des jeux comme Fortnite. Il est réputé pour sa puissance et sa capacité à créer des mondes 3D réalistes. Il est aussi très utilisé pour la réalité virtuelle (VR).

Même s’il est très avancé, Unreal Engine propose un système appelé « Blueprints ». C’est une interface de script visuel qui permet de créer des mécaniques de jeu sans écrire de code. La courbe d’apprentissage est plus raide que pour d’autres moteurs, mais le résultat peut être spectaculaire. Le moteur est gratuit jusqu’à ce que votre jeu génère 1 million de dollars de revenus.

Pour des projets 3D de haute qualité, vous pouvez explorer Unreal Engine.

5. Godot Engine : L’alternative open-source et légère

Godot Engine est un concurrent direct de Unity, mais avec une différence majeure : il est entièrement gratuit et open-source. Il n’y a aucune condition de revenus ou de version payante. L’application est aussi très légère et rapide à lancer.

Il est capable de gérer des projets 2D et 3D. Pour le code, il utilise son propre langage, le GDScript, qui est très proche de Python et donc facile à apprendre. Sa communauté est très active et bienveillante avec les nouveaux utilisateurs. Si vous aimez l’esprit du logiciel libre, Godot est un excellent choix.

Pour le tester, vous pouvez télécharger Godot Engine.

6. RPG Maker VX : Pour créer le jeu de rôle de vos rêves

Comme son nom l’indique, RPG Maker est un logiciel spécialisé dans la création de RPG (jeux de rôle) en 2D, dans un style rétro rappelant les classiques de l’ère 16-bits. Si c’est votre genre de jeu favori, cette application est faite pour vous.

Il ne demande aucune programmation. Tout se fait via des menus et des éditeurs de cartes. Le logiciel vient avec de nombreuses ressources de base (personnages, décors, musiques) pour commencer à créer votre propre jeu immédiatement. C’est un outil très accessible pour raconter une histoire interactive.

Pour créer votre aventure, vous pouvez voir RPG Maker VX.

7. CryEngine : Le moteur des jeux aux graphismes avancés

CryEngine est un autre moteur 3D de référence, connu pour avoir été utilisé sur des jeux comme Crysis et le premier Far Cry. Il est célèbre pour ses capacités en matière de graphismes photoréalistes, notamment pour la gestion de la végétation et de la lumière.

C’est un outil très puissant mais sa courbe d’apprentissage est élevée. Il s’adresse plutôt aux utilisateurs qui ont déjà une certaine expérience en développement de jeux. Comme Unreal, il propose un modèle économique sans frais initiaux, avec une redevance sur les revenus du jeu.

Pour les projets graphiquement exigeants, vous pouvez découvrir CryEngine.

8. Gamemaker : L’équilibre entre simplicité et flexibilité

Gamemaker existe depuis longtemps et a permis de créer des jeux 2D à succès comme Undertale ou Hotline Miami. Il offre un bon équilibre entre une approche visuelle (avec un système de « Drag and Drop ») et la possibilité de coder avec son propre langage, le GML (GameMaker Language), qui est facile à apprendre.

C’est un excellent outil pour le développement rapide de prototypes ou de jeux 2D complets. La version gratuite permet de publier des jeux sur le web. Pour exporter sur d’autres plateformes comme PC ou mobile, il faut passer à une version payante.

Pour un développement rapide, vous pouvez essayer Gamemaker.

9. LÖVE : Pour ceux qui veulent apprendre le code (LUA)

LÖVE n’est pas un moteur de jeu complet avec une interface, mais un framework 2D minimaliste. Pour l’utiliser, il faut écrire du code avec le langage LUA, un langage de script connu pour sa simplicité. C’est une approche différente, plus proche de la programmation pure.

Cette application est parfaite si votre but est d’apprendre à coder en créant un jeu. LÖVE est très léger et flexible, vous donnant un contrôle total sur votre création. Il y a moins d’outils « tout prêts », mais c’est une excellente façon de comprendre comment un jeu vidéo fonctionne de l’intérieur.

Pour vous lancer dans le code, vous pouvez découvrir LÖVE.

Comment Choisir la Bonne Application pour Votre Projet ?

Choisir le bon moteur de jeu est la première étape importante. Pour ne pas vous tromper, posez-vous quelques questions simples sur votre projet et vos compétences.

  • Votre niveau de compétence : C’est le critère le plus important. Si vous débutez complètement, une application sans code comme GDevelop ou Construct est idéale. Si vous avez déjà quelques bases ou que vous voulez apprendre à programmer, Unity ou Godot sont de bons choix.
  • Le type de jeu que vous voulez créer : Votre idée de jeu influence le choix de l’outil. Pour un jeu de rôle 2D, RPG Maker est tout indiqué. Pour un jeu 3D avec de beaux graphismes, Unreal Engine est le meilleur. Pour la plupart des autres jeux 2D, GDevelop ou Gamemaker sont parfaits.
  • Les plateformes cibles : Où voulez-vous que les joueurs jouent à votre jeu ? Sur PC, mobile, ou directement sur un navigateur web ? La plupart des moteurs comme Unity ou GDevelop sont multiplateformes, mais vérifiez bien les options d’exportation de chaque application.
  • La communauté et les ressources disponibles : Quand vous serez bloqué, une communauté active est une aide précieuse. Unity et Unreal Engine ont les plus grandes communautés, avec d’innombrables tutoriels et forums. Godot a aussi une communauté très solidaire.

Foire Aux Questions (FAQ) sur la création de jeux vidéo gratuits

Quel est le meilleur logiciel pour créer un jeu sans savoir coder ?

Pour un débutant qui ne veut pas toucher au code, GDevelop est probablement le meilleur choix. Son système d’événements est facile à comprendre et il permet d’exporter son jeu sur de nombreuses plateformes. Construct 3 est une autre excellente option, surtout si vous préférez travailler directement dans votre navigateur.

Unity ou Unreal Engine : lequel choisir pour un débutant ?

Unity est généralement considéré comme plus accessible pour un débutant. Son interface est un peu plus simple à prendre en main et le langage C# est très bien documenté. Unreal Engine est plus puissant pour les graphismes 3D, mais sa courbe d’apprentissage est plus raide. Si votre objectif est la 3D photoréaliste, l’effort peut valoir le coup.

Peut-on vendre un jeu créé avec un logiciel gratuit ?

Oui, la plupart des moteurs de jeu gratuits vous autorisent à vendre vos créations. Cependant, les conditions varient :

  • Les logiciels open-source comme Godot ou GDevelop ne vous imposent aucune restriction.
  • Les moteurs comme Unity ou Unreal Engine demandent une redevance ou un abonnement si votre jeu dépasse un certain seuil de revenus. Vérifiez toujours la licence de l’application que vous utilisez.

Combien de temps faut-il pour créer son premier jeu ?

Cela dépend entièrement de l’ampleur de votre projet. Avec un outil comme GDevelop, vous pouvez créer un mini-jeu simple en un week-end. Pour un projet plus conséquent, cela peut prendre plusieurs mois, voire des années. Le meilleur conseil est de commencer petit : créez un jeu très simple pour apprendre les bases, puis passez à des projets plus ambitieux.

Articles similaires